# INSTALL ## Copy Library Code to Your Project This is the recommended way to use this library. Copy [ctlseqs.h](src/ctlseqs.h) and [ctlseqs.c](src/ctlseqs.c) to your project and build it alongside with other code. Requires an ISO C99 and POSIX.1-2008 compliant C implementation. ## Build and Install From Source Helper scripts are provided to build ctlseqs as a shared/static library. Requires GNU Autoconf, Automake, Libtool and Autoconf Archive. ```shell autoreconf --install ./configure --prefix=$HOME CFLAGS='-O0 -g' make ``` Optionally, you can run tests (requires DejaGnu), install the binary and man pages. ```shell make check && make install ``` Finally, link it to your project with the `-lctlseqs` flag (or something similar). ## Install From a Package Manager We maintain unofficial repositories for a few package managers, so that the ctlseqs library can be installed from them. However, there is no guarantee that any of those repositories will be actively maintained in the future. ### Homebrew ```shell brew tap CismonX/repos brew install ctlseqs ```
